Introduction: The Allure of Rat Rod Culture
Rat rods are more than just old cars; they are a statement. Born from the desire to rebel against the polished perfection of traditional hot rods, rat rods are typically characterized by their unfinished, rusted appearance. This aesthetic, which might be considered "ugly" by classic car standards, is precisely what makes rat rods so appealing. They captivate car enthusiasts with their raw authenticity and the story each car tells about its builder's creativity and resourcefulness.
The History of Rat Rods
The roots of rat rods can be traced back to the early days of hot rodding in the mid-20th century. As traditional hot rods became more refined and expensive, a counter-culture emerged, emphasizing the DIY spirit and using whatever parts were available. Key figures like Ed "Big Daddy" Roth and events such as the early custom car shows played pivotal roles in popularizing this raw, unrefined style. Rat rods gained momentum in the late 20th century, embodying a return to the basics and a nod to the past.
Distinctive Features of Rat Rods
What sets rat rods apart from their hot rod cousins is their distinctive appearance. Unlike the gleaming, polished hot rods, rat rods proudly wear their rust and patina. They often feature mismatched parts, exposed engines, and an overall aesthetic that screams rebellion. This "unfinished" look is not a result of neglect, but a deliberate stylistic choice that celebrates imperfection and individuality.
Building a Rat Rod: A DIY Endeavor
Building a rat rod is a labor of love, requiring a mix of creativity, skill, and resourcefulness. Enthusiasts need essential tools like welders, grinders, and an assortment of hand tools. The construction process involves sourcing parts from junkyards, flea markets, and online swaps, often leading to unexpected challenges. But overcoming these hurdles is part of the rat rod mystique, rewarding builders with a unique creation that's a reflection of their ingenuity.
The Art of Customization
Customization is at the heart of every rat rod. Each vehicle is a canvas for the builder's artistic vision, where creativity knows no bounds. From incorporating household items as functional parts to crafting intricate metalwork, the possibilities are endless. Iconic designs often feature imaginative themes, such as a rat rod styled after a World War II bomber or one that resembles a post-apocalyptic survivor vehicle.
Rat Rod Culture and Community
The rat rod community thrives on camaraderie and shared passion. Key events, such as the Rat Rod Magazine Tour and the Viva Las Vegas Rockabilly Weekend, bring enthusiasts together to showcase their creations and swap stories. Online forums and social media groups also play a crucial role, allowing builders to connect, share tips, and inspire each other across the globe.
